Bean & Chorizo Tostaditas
- 6 oz of loose Chorizo Sausage
- 1 large or 2 medium Jalepeno peppers finely diced
- 1/2 of medium onion finely chopped
- 28 oz of mashed pinto beans (refried)
- 1 package of round nacho chips(9-14 oz)
- 8 oz of shredded Quesadilla or Oaxaca cheese
- for garnish:
- finely chopped tomatoes
- chopped Cilantro
- Chopped green onion
- Dollop of sour cream
- Saute jalapeno pepper, onion, and chorizo in a medium skillet over medium heat. When sausage is cooked, add the beans. Simmer until warm, approximately 10 minutes.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Spoon mixture onto round nacho chips. Top mixture with grated quesadilla or Oaxaca cheese. Place under broiler until cheese is melted and slightly browned. About 3-5 minutes. Remove and garnish as desired
- Serve immediately
